#cd06cb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cd06cb is composed of 80.4% red, 2.4%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.1% magenta, 1%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 300.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 41.4%. #cd06c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#9b0097.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#cd06cb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e000e is the darkest color, while #fffa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d06cb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c676c is the less saturated color, while #cd06cb is the most saturated one.
